Donasia
Pronounced doh-NAY-zhuh /doʊˈneɪʒə/Low
Meaning: Donasia is a modern American coinage joining a Do- or Dona- element to the fashionable -asia ending, seen in names like Tanasia and Aniyah's wider family. It carries no single traditional meaning; the parts are traced honestly rather than given a false root.Low

History & Origin
Donasia is a modern coinage built from a Do- element and the -asia ending popular at the turn of the millennium. It appears in American records mainly in the two-thousands and is best read by its parts rather than a single inherited meaning.
It was always rare, given to only about sixteen girls a year even at its peak in the two-thousands. A girl named Donasia then is still young today, in her twenties.
